Philadelphia 76ers star centre Joel Embiid is experiencing left knee soreness, and as a result, will be out approximately one week, the team announced Wednesday.

The team says an MRI revealed that Embiid has no structural damage and is being held out as a precaution.

Embiid, 24, has averaged 27.3 points per game and 13.5 rebounds this season, en route to being named an all-star for the second consecutive year.

With the help of the fourth-year man, the 76ers have tallied a 37-21 record, which has them sitting fifth in the Eastern Conference and six and half games out of first place.
